    Hi,

    I sent a letter to BOI, Mainguard Street in Galway on 8-Apr asking them to close my current account.  I provided a separate account to transfer any remaining balance.  I have tried calling directly numerous time but only get through to a "BOI Direct" system.

    What is the delay?

    How can I determine where my request is and why it has not been processed?

    Thanks Sarah,

    Unfortunately ringing any BIO branch e.g. Mainguard Street 091567181 or GMIT 091755347 gets you through to the BOI Direct.  

    So to close an a/c I was told to send a letter to my branch - which I did.
    Apparently that letter then gets re-directed to a different location for processing.  In my case the letter is now lost so the recommendation is to resend a copy.

    Surely it must be possible to scan in a copy and email this rather than waiting a number of days to see if a letter was received?

    [font=Verdana, sans-serif]We are sorry to hear the account closure letter will need to be resent. It will be necessary to resend the letter by post or hand the letter into any nearby branch. If we may advise on the letter request, to include a contact number and request a staff member to contact you by phone once the letter has been received. [/font]
    [font=Verdana, sans-serif] [/font]
    [font=Verdana, sans-serif]Although it is not possible to scan, email or fax this request, we will certainly pass on your suggestions to our Branch Network Team as we do understand a repeat of this request can be time consuming for you.[/font]
    [font=Verdana, sans-serif] [/font]
    [font=Verdana, sans-serif]Just in relation to the time frame of such a request, when the new letter is sent, depending from where the letter is being posted from, we would ask 3-5 working days to receive this and a further 2 working days to process the request.[/font]
